World Cup: 'Wasim bhai ke retirement ke baad..,' Virender Sehwag takes swipe at Pakistan bowling attack

Pakistan’s campaign at the World Cup 2023 suffered a huge blow after New Zealand clinched a five-wicket win over Sri Lanka in Bengaluru. The Babar Azam-led side’s hopes of earning a semi-final spot hinged heavily on a Sri Lankan triumph against New Zealand. But after Sri Lanka’s defeat, Pakistan will now have to beat England by a margin of at least 287 runs to secure a place in the knockout stages. While achieving such a result is not beyond the realm of possibility, it is undeniably a formidable challenge. Former India cricketer Virender Sehwag, known for his candid remarks, recently took a dig at Pakistan following their diminished semi-final hopes. He shared a ‘Pakistan Zindabhaag’ post on social media platform X, formerly Twitter.

Sehwag’s tweet did trigger a flurry of reactions from Pakistan and it also led to a heated exchange of words between fans from both sides of the border. One fan said that Sehwag was repeatedly troubled by Pakistan bowlers in the past. Another fan was quick to respond, saying that Sehwag had an impressive average of 91 against Pakistan. Sehwag also took a swipe at Pakistan’s bowling attack. Sehwag said that Pakistan’s bowling performance post-Wasim Akram’s retirement did not meet his standards.

He quoted the fan’s tweet and wrote, “Nahi yaar, Wasim bhai ke retirement ke baad jaise yeh thhey, 200 ki avg honi chahiye tha inke saath. But jo bhi ho , tab bhi aur ab bhi Inke Mazzey lene mein maza aata hai. [No, man. After Wasim bhai’s retirement, the way their bowling attack was, I should have had an average of 200. Anyway, it was fun against them then, and even now].” Pakistan cricket team’s performance at the World Cup has truly been disappointing this time. Several reports even suggest that Pakistan captain Babar Azam could be asked to step down from his position and a number of new players can be given a chance to stake a claim in the national side.
